Getting Started: Choosing the Right IKEA Products

The first step in this DIY project is to select the right IKEA products to serve as the foundation for your kitchen island. Some popular options include the IKEA Kallax shelf unit, the IKEA Hemnes dresser, or the IKEA Stenstorp kitchen cart. Consider the size and layout of your kitchen, as well as your storage needs, when choosing the appropriate product.

Gathering the Tools and Materials

Once you have chosen the base IKEA product, it’s time to gather the necessary tools and materials. You will need basic tools such as a screwdriver, drill, and hammer, as well as sandpaper, paint or stain, and any additional hardware or accessories you wish to add to your kitchen island.

Assembling the IKEA Furniture

Follow the instructions provided by IKEA to assemble the base furniture. Make sure to double-check all connections and ensure that the structure is stable and secure. This step is crucial as it sets the foundation for your DIY kitchen island.

Enhancing Functionality

A kitchen island should not only look good but also serve a purpose. Consider adding features that enhance the functionality of your DIY creation. You can install hooks or racks for hanging pots, pans, or utensils. Incorporate a wine rack or a spice organizer. Think about your specific cooking and entertaining needs and tailor your kitchen island accordingly.

Finishing Touches

Once you have customized your kitchen island to your satisfaction, it’s time to add the finishing touches. Give the entire piece a final sanding to ensure a smooth surface. Apply a protective coat of varnish or sealant to preserve the finish and make it easier to clean.
